Celebrity recognition in a video is an // asynchronous operation. Analysis is started by a call to // StartCelebrityRecognition which returns a job identifier ( JobId ). When the // celebrity recognition operation finishes, Amazon Rekognition Video publishes a // completion status to the Amazon Simple Notification Service topic registered in // the initial call to StartCelebrityRecognition . To get the results of the // celebrity recognition analysis, first check that the status value published to // the Amazon SNS topic is SUCCEEDED . If so, call GetCelebrityDetection and pass // the job identifier ( JobId ) from the initial call to StartCelebrityDetection . // For more information, see Working With Stored Videos in the Amazon Rekognition // Developer Guide. GetCelebrityRecognition returns detected celebrities and the // time(s) they are detected in an array ( Celebrities ) of CelebrityRecognition // objects. Each CelebrityRecognition contains information about the celebrity in // a CelebrityDetail object and the time, Timestamp , the celebrity was detected. // This CelebrityDetail object stores information about the detected celebrity's // face attributes, a face bounding box, known gender, the celebrity's name, and a // confidence estimate. GetCelebrityRecognition only returns the default facial // attributes ( BoundingBox , Confidence , Landmarks , Pose , and Quality ). The // BoundingBox field only applies to the detected face instance. The other facial // attributes listed in the Face object of the following response syntax are not // returned. For more information, see FaceDetail in the Amazon Rekognition // Developer Guide. By default, the Celebrities array is sorted by time // (milliseconds from the start of the video). You can also sort the array by // celebrity by specifying the value ID in the SortBy input parameter. The // CelebrityDetail object includes the celebrity identifer and additional // information urls. If you don't store the additional information urls, you can // get them later by calling GetCelebrityInfo with the celebrity identifer. No // information is returned for faces not recognized as celebrities. Use MaxResults // parameter to limit the number of labels returned. If there are more results than // specified in MaxResults , the value of NextToken in the operation response // contains a pagination token for getting the next set of results.
